To clarify: the extra pro-mode costs for DLC is ONLY for the Guitar/Bass track, since they're totally different from the regular game. Pro-mode drums and keyboards (and vocals, if they exist?) are included in the base DLC. In fact, Harmonix recently said that all the pro mode data for Drums has been in the series since the first Rock Band, so you'll be able to enjoy Pro Mode Drums immediately for your entire Rock Band library.

Post by KStrick on Oct 12, 2010 15:14:27 GMT -5
I don't get this, I had to unlock the pro mode in all the songs that came with the game with funbucks? No. All the songs in Rock Band 3 have "regular" mode, and pro mode. The songs we are talking about having to pay extra for is DLC only. And only DLC released 26 October and on. There are rumors Harmonix is going back to update previous songs that aren't Pro-Mode ready (keys and guitar/bass), and update them to be Pro Mode in RB3.
